Federal Facilities Section
Last updated June 7, 2017
The Federal Facilities Section provides oversight and review of investigations, management and remediation of hazardous (chemical and radiological) substances at federal facilities in Missouri. Federal facilities include sites both currently and previously owned or operated by the Department of Defense or the Department of Energy. In addition, the Federal Facilities Section provides guidance to ensure activities conducted at the sites are in accordance with both state and federal environmental laws and regulations.
